Release runbook — Pooler rollout (Kestrelbase)

Before cutover, drain the old connection pool. Set max_conns to 40 per node; Kestrelbase falls over above 50. Restart the pooler sidecar first, then the API pods, in that order. Watch for checkout timeouts in the first five minutes. If saturation exceeds 80%, roll back immediately. Do not tune idle_timeout mid-deploy. The signed rollout manifest must be verified with the key below.

release key, fahaf-bajof: bky3_Xam

## Escalation — Plotpin Address Autocomplete

If suggestion latency exceeds 400ms p95 for 10 minutes, restart the suggestion nodes one at a time. If results return empty for valid prefixes, check the index-sync job first; a stale index is the usual cause. Do not rebuild the index during business hours. Page the geo team lead if two restarts don't resolve it. For all other questions, send mail here.

billing contact of tahaf-kafop = istwyn_fraox@norvaworks.corp

## Environments: Partner SFTP Drop

The Ferndrop service runs three environments — dev, staging, and prod — and each has its own partner SFTP drop folder. Partners upload nightly batches; the poller on our side picks them up within about ten minutes. If a partner says their file "vanished," it almost always landed in the wrong environment. Check the drop paths before escalating. The active configuration values for each environment are listed below.

settings of tajep-tafog:
CASDOR_LOG_LEVEL=info
CASDOR_METRICS_HOST=metrics.casdor.nelvrosys.internal
CASDOR_POOL_SIZE=16

## Releases

DeployWren, our chat bot for deploy status, follows a two-week release cadence aligned with the eng sync. Each release is tagged, changelog entries are reviewed by the on-call rotation, and the bot's status commands are smoke-tested against the Hallowmere staging cluster before promotion. Rollbacks are one command and take under a minute. Every release artifact must be signed prior to upload, using the key provided immediately below.

deploy key for kajof-fajop: bky6_gDHw9Q